95/**
b2da4a4d 96 * parse_string(): Parse a JSON string
4a5fcab7 97 *
b2da4a4d
MA
98 * From RFC 8259 "The JavaScript Object Notation (JSON) Data
99 * Interchange Format":
100 *
101 * char = unescaped /
102 * escape (
103 * %x22 / ; " quotation mark U+0022
104 * %x5C / ; \ reverse solidus U+005C
105 * %x2F / ; / solidus U+002F
106 * %x62 / ; b backspace U+0008
107 * %x66 / ; f form feed U+000C
108 * %x6E / ; n line feed U+000A
109 * %x72 / ; r carriage return U+000D
110 * %x74 / ; t tab U+0009
111 * %x75 4HEXDIG ) ; uXXXX U+XXXX
112 * escape = %x5C ; \
113 * quotation-mark = %x22 ; "
114 * unescaped = %x20-21 / %x23-5B / %x5D-10FFFF
115 *
116 * Extensions over RFC 8259:
117 * - Extra escape sequence in strings:
118 * 0x27 (apostrophe) is recognized after escape, too
119 * - Single-quoted strings:
120 * Like double-quoted strings, except they're delimited by %x27
121 * (apostrophe) instead of %x22 (quotation mark), and can't contain
122 * unescaped apostrophe, but can contain unescaped quotation mark.
123 *
124 * Note:
125 * - Encoding is modified UTF-8.
126 * - Invalid Unicode characters are rejected.
127 * - Control characters \x00..\x1F are rejected by the lexer.
4a5fcab7 128 */
